Aerobious

/ɛˈroʊbiəs/ adjective

Relating to or living in air; requiring oxygen for life; essentially synonymous with aerobic.

From aero- (air) + -bious (from bios, life) + -ous (adjective suffix); an older adjectival form less common in modern scientific usage.
